How to spell PARENIAL correctly?
If you meant to write "perennial" but misspelled it as "parenial", here are a few correct suggestions. Perennial refers to plants that come back year after year. The correct spelling is "perennial". Common misspellings include "prenial", "perenial" or "parenneal". Remember to double-check your spelling to ensure clarity in your writing.
